Understanding Final Expense Insurance: A Comprehensive Guide

Final expense insurance is designed to cover the costs associated with end-of-life expenses, providing peace of mind for both the policyholder and their loved ones. Unlike traditional life insurance policies, which may offer a large death benefit to cover various needs, final expense insurance focuses specifically on covering funeral, burial, and other related costs. In this blog post, we’ll explore what final expense insurance is, its benefits, and why it might be a crucial part of your financial planning.

What is Final Expense Insurance?

Final expense insurance, sometimes referred to as burial or funeral insurance, is a type of whole life insurance policy that provides a designated amount of coverage to help cover the costs associated with a person’s final arrangements. This type of insurance ensures that end-of-life expenses are covered without placing a financial burden on family members.

Key Features of Final Expense Insurance

1. Fixed Premiums

  • Predictable Costs: Premiums for final expense insurance are typically fixed, meaning you’ll pay the same amount throughout the life of the policy. This predictability helps in budgeting and financial planning.

2. Guaranteed Coverage

  • Acceptance: Final expense insurance often has more lenient qualification requirements compared to other types of life insurance, making it easier for individuals with health issues to secure coverage.
  • No Medical Exam: Many policies do not require a medical exam, and coverage is guaranteed based on the application.

3. Whole Life Insurance

  • Lifetime Coverage: Final expense insurance is a form of whole life insurance, which means it provides coverage for the insured’s entire life as long as premiums are paid.
  • Cash Value: Policies may accumulate a cash value over time, which can be borrowed against or used to pay premiums.

Understanding Fixed Premiums in Final Expense Insurance

When exploring final expense insurance, one of the key features to consider is fixed premiums. This aspect of the policy plays a significant role in determining its affordability and overall value. Here’s a detailed look at what fixed premiums mean in the context of final expense insurance and why they matter.

What Are Fixed Premiums?

Fixed premiums refer to the consistent and unchanging amount of money that you pay periodically (usually monthly) for your final expense insurance policy. Unlike some types of insurance where premiums may fluctuate based on age, health, or market conditions, fixed premiums remain constant for the duration of the policy.

How Fixed Premiums Work in Final Expense Insurance

1. Premium Payment Schedule

  • Regular Payments: Fixed premiums are typically paid on a regular schedule, such as monthly, quarterly, or annually. You select the payment frequency that best fits your financial situation.
  • Automatic Payments: Many insurers offer the option to set up automatic payments, ensuring that you never miss a premium and keeping your policy active.

2. Policy Duration

  • Lifetime Coverage: In most final expense insurance policies, fixed premiums contribute to lifetime coverage, meaning you’ll be covered as long as premiums are paid.
  • No Expiration: Unlike term life insurance, which expires after a set period, final expense insurance with fixed premiums continues indefinitely, providing lasting financial protection.
